Is There Such A Thing As Fair Trade Jewelry? A Google seek for "honest commerce jewellery" will deliver up numerous corporations, lots of which promote ethnic jewellery produced in small villages within the growing world. The concept draws the socially responsible shopper, yet the third celebration labeling organization, Fair Labeling Organization (FLO) - of which Transfair USA is a member - does not presently checklist jewellery. Apart from that, some giant gamers within the mainstream jewellery business are starting to tout concepts akin to "honest trade diamonds" and "honest commerce gold." So how does one make sense of these jewellery claims, particularly as they relate to the $150 Billion mainstream jewellery industry? Investigating the Self-Proclaimed Fair Trade Jewelers Global Exchange comes up primary on Google within the organic, unpaid listings for the "fair trade" jewellery search. The Transfair logo on the bottom of their web site would lead a client to believe that their jewelry, just like the coffee they promote, is third occasion certified. In the context of their claim, I emailed them, asking concerning the source of their valuable metallic and the environmental safeguard for their manufacturers - correct ventilation and disposal or poisonous chemical compounds used within the manufacturing of the jewelry they promote. Finally, sterling silver is meant to be .925% silver. Imports out of small villages in growing nations are notorious for labeling as sterling silver jewellery which has much less silver content material than actual sterling silver. Global Exchange wrote again explaining that their jewellery is made in a village by small scale artisans and honest working circumstances, which they monitor. They could not answer questions about the environmental practices of those small producers and did not monitor sterling content material. This utility of the term "honest commerce" to jewelry by Global Exchange is backed by a fair commerce idea that exists outside of FLO. Global Exchange also referred me to the Fair Trade Federation (FTF), of which they're a member. FTF's website FAQ pages lists jewelry as a product. I interviewed Carmen Iezzi, the executive director of FTF, which helped me understand that FTF has nothing to do with products: only businesses that sell them-a subtle distinction most likely misplaced on the average person. Global Exchange, at least, has some history behind their ethical stance; there are many companies and stores using the ideas of "fair" and "eco" round their products with more questionable accountability. Though "fair commerce" jewellery helps some villagers within the developing world, it is a negligible niche market in the mainstream jewelry trade as a whole, which does over hundred and fifty billion dollars annually. The Difficulty of Fair Trade in the Main Stream Jewelry Industry Taking the idea of "truthful trade" jewelry out of the village and into the mainstream world jewelry market (assume gold, diamonds, bling bling) is like banging that outdated square peg in a round gap. At present, the industry is completely commodity based mostly and value driven, considerably like lumber or oil. Fair trade ideas are simply not a part of the paradigm. Consider the final circumstances required for a fair commerce merchandise which is pretty straight forward: coffee. The beans are organically grown usually in farms that work collectively, fostering entrepreneurship which translates into broader group prosperity. Third celebration certification assures a stage of integrity that the ethical consumer shopping for at Whole Foods feels good about. To translate the same concept into a jewelry product, one would have to consider labor and environmental practices within the sourcing of precious metal and gem stones. Mining and improvement of the raw materials - steel refining and gemstone chopping - are additional steps. Manufacturing a finished product presents one other process with its own labor and environmental issues. Plus, there is a wide range of knickknack merchandise, from toy rings to the high finish. Attempting to come to an agreed upon standards of what's moral with such an elaborate, disparate supply chain is daunting. The Ethical Sourcing Movement within the Mainstream Jewelry Industry Meanwhile, a small section of passionate, dedicated individuals in the mainstream jewellery business are trying to outline "ethical sourcing", with the final word goal of some form of agreed upon standards resulting in true, third occasion certification. This is going to be an extended process. An Ethical Jewelry Summit organized by Earthworks Action is scheduled in Washington DC in late October, 2007. The jewellery industry derives most of its revenues from diamonds, valuable and gem stones and valuable metal. The ethical sourcing motion has attracted the curiosity of governments, large corporations and the World Bank, the place the Washington assembly is to take place. Most raw supplies in the jewelry business are sourced from small scale mining, and efforts are below method to deliver ethical practices to this sector. FLO's early efforts focus on ARM (Association For Responsible Mining). Some firms, such because the Rapaport Group and Columbia Gem House, have taken robust initiatives on their very own, extrapolating the truthful commerce idea to use to gemstone sourcing. However, valuable metals and gems in themselves don't make up a whole piece of bijou. Though a completed piece of jewelry may very well be analogous to a fair trade chocolate bar which can have components which can be independently licensed, we cannot have ethically sourced jewelry without addressing manufacturing which has its personal labor and environmental considerations. Unlike espresso, mainstream jewelry can't be easily manufactured in a developing world village as a result of it requires an enormous preliminary investment in equipment and uncooked materials. Apart from companies that supply their manufactured products from moral factories, the most notable experiment in this regard is going down in South Africa in a venture known as, Vukani-Ubuntu. The project basically trains individuals from local townships into the main steam jewelry commerce, offering coaching, mentoring and equipment. It is closely supported by government and NGOs. But in accordance with Lores Mares, CEO of the South African Jewelry Counsel, one of the crucial difficult challenges is bringing the product to a market. Jewelry is strictly a commodity that's heavily cost driven. This ethical sourcing idea doesn't deliver added value because the market is undeveloped. My anecdotal research exhibits that the progressive, inexperienced shopper who buys from Patagonia does not feel comfortable with a typical jewelry sales individual. Winning the progressive eco demographic again can be straightforward. Yet those within the mainstream jewellery world who are involved are sincere and heavily driven by humanitarian issues-with the doable exception of the larger firms who could also be joining to polish their blood diamond, soiled gold image. Though millions of internet sites reference "truthful commerce jewellery," the designation is, at this point, too ambiguous for all but a couple of fundamental stream jewelry manufacturers to use. The client considering ethically sourced jewelry must search for detailed info as to sourcing, labor and environmental practices. At present, transparency is commonly extra precious to the buyer than any designation.
